- ADP/ CDK Booking and timekeeping for service department
- Meet and greet service customers promptly in a professional and courteous manner.
- Liaison between the service and sales department.
- Realize that business is built on customer satisfaction and be devoted to guaranteeing satisfaction to our customers.
- Establish personal goals that are consistent with dealership standards of productivity, and devise a strategy to meet those goals.
- Learn to overcome objections.
- Follow all company policies and procedures.
- Demonstrates behaviors consistent with the Company’s Values in all interactions with customers, co-workers and vendors.
- At least 1 year of sales, service, or accounting in the Automotive industry experience required.
- ADP/ CDK experiencea plus
- Confidence in your ability to be successful.
- A desire to work in a commission, performance-based, environment.
- Great attitude with high-energy personality.
- Excellent customer service skills.
- Professional appearance and work ethic.
- Self-starter and self-motivated.
- Ability to work well in a process driven environment.
- Outstanding communication skills in both verbal and written.
- High school diploma or equivalent.
- Valid driver license in the state that you will work and a good driving record.
Compensation: $25.00 to $30.00 an hour
